My buddy and I went sat and tore the specks up we seemed to be the only ones really hittin em hard, been awhile since I've been on em like that 9:30 we were done
i'll b honest, if you're gonna post a report with or without pics.. provide some actual detail... where the hell were you, what was the wind like, water temps and clarity, baits used and even type of retreive are valuable information that we all appreciate in a good report... with or without pics.

and IMO, pics do not make a report, DETAILS MAKE THE REPORT. pics just illustrate the report.
